Discover the beauty of the Southern Great Barrier Reef. Great Keppel Island is one of the most underrated and pristine islands on the Great Barrier Reef. Surrounded by 17 beaches, there are 1454 hectares to explore on GKI alone, let alone on the rest of the islands in the surrounding Keppel Archipelago. Tourism & Reef Conservation
The team at Keppel Dive & Water Sports are committed to the long-term conservation and education of the Great Barrier Reef and particularly here in the Keppel Group, a gem in the Southern Great Barrier Reef. Through our active partnerships with The Great Barrier Reef Marine Park Authority, supporting the Australian Institute of Marine Science’s research, working with Traditional Owners, and helping to deliver Traineeships for young Indigenous and non-Indigenous local students, Keppel Dive & Water Sports is invested in the future of the Great Barrier Reef. We love to share our citizen science efforts and want our guests to leave with a greater understanding and appreciation for the Southern Great Barrier reef and the knowledge that everyone can make a difference!
